After a week of transmitting "black", there is now programming on KCVH Channel 30, but with a very poor, almost useless signal at my location around 25 miles from the transmitter. They are obviously on reduced power, as I would be just within the 74dBu contour if they were running full throttle, according to the coverage map on the FCC site. LP channels 21 and 43 both put in decent signals on my portable set with a hoop UHF antenna, and even lesser powered 34 is viewable here. But it looks like 30 has more work to do before they are running full strength. Audio is an issue as well, very low level, well below the relative carrier strength.LAT-TV was running its "Cocina Nativa" cooking show while I was checking the signal.
